Avante Mezzanine Partners, headquartered in Los Angeles with an office in Boston, is a mezzanine fund that specializes in providing both debt and equity financing to profitable, lower middle market companies across the United States. They emphasize supporting transactions for sponsored and non-sponsored businesses, with their financial commitments ranging from $5 million to $20 million. Their typical investment targets are companies with an EBITDA of $3 million to $15 million, and they are dedicated to facilitating various financial operations such as buyouts, growth capital infusions, strategic acquisitions, leveraged recapitalizations, and refinancing options. The firm has successfully closed its first fund with $218 million in commitments. With over 70 years of collective investment experience, their Partners bring a wealth of knowledge and expertise in supporting sponsors, entrepreneurs, and management teams to foster growth and success. Avante Mezzanine Partners positions itself as a women-owned fund that takes a particular interest, though not exclusively, in financing enterprises that are owned or operated by women and minorities. Their industry expertise is broad, spanning across Aerospace and Defense, Business Services, Consumer Products, Distribution, Education, Healthcare & Life Sciences, Industrial / Manufacturing, Security Products / Services, Software / IT Services, and Specialty Chemicals / Coatings. They take pride in their unique approach to private credit, leveraging diversity to challenge standards and create opportunities for their partners and communities often underrepresented in the industry. As one of the largest women- and minority-owned private credit firms in the United States, they manage nearly $1 billion in assets and strive to make significant impacts in the lower middle market through strategic partnerships and the Avante ecosystem.
